如何使按钮在eclipse中执行特定的.java文件

如何使按钮在eclipse中执行特定的.java文件,java,Java,所以我试着为我的朋友制作这个程序,它会给你一个Minecraft的随机alt(电子邮件和密码)。我已经想出了一个方法,给一个随机的电子邮件和密码,但我需要一个gui打开显示密码和电子邮件。有没有办法给按钮编码 我当前的随机alt代码是 public class NameGenerator { public static void main(String[] args) { String[] names = {"email", "email"}; int index = (int)

所以我试着为我的朋友制作这个程序,它会给你一个Minecraft的随机alt(电子邮件和密码)。我已经想出了一个方法,给一个随机的电子邮件和密码,但我需要一个gui打开显示密码和电子邮件。有没有办法给按钮编码

我当前的随机alt代码是

public class NameGenerator {
public static void main(String[] args) {
    String[] names = {"email", "email"};
    int index = (int) (Math.random() * names.length);
    String name = names[index];
    System.out.println("Your random alt is " + name + " Have Fun and also DM me on Discord if this alt does not work @________#0000!");
    }
}

你知道如何用java创建GUI吗?不有非常简单的教程介绍如何使用。找一个。创建一个按钮。双击该按钮,它将带您进入生成的按钮
ActionListener
或类似按钮。写下你想要它做什么。

这里可以使用Java SWING。查看您是否正在寻找类似以下代码的内容

public static void main(String[] args) {
    JFrame f=new JFrame();  

    JButton b=new JButton("Get Password");  
    b.setBounds(50,120,120,30);  

    b.addActionListener(new ActionListener(){  
        public void actionPerformed(ActionEvent e){  

            String[] names = {"email", "email"};
            int index = (int) (Math.random() * names.length);
            String name = names[index];
            String msg = "Your random alt is " + name + " Have Fun and also DM me on Discord if this alt does not work @________#0000!";

            JOptionPane.showMessageDialog(f, msg);
        }  
    });  

    f.add(b);
    f.setSize(400,400);  
    f.setLayout(null);  
    f.setVisible(true);   
}

或者在你提问之前,你必须做一些研究。否则,我们不知道您遇到了什么困难,只是在为您编写代码。我正在尝试创建一个可以在.jar文件上运行的gui,该文件可以运行上述代码并在gui上显示它。比如,如果你告诉我如何自己解决这个问题,我该如何编辑按钮的功能是的,非常感谢你的帮助,我没有使用所有的代码,但我找到了答案,谢谢@PandemicFTW plz如果解决了您的目的,请接受答案:-)